I've been loads of times to Kinsley, and if your backing one dog in a race, go outside to the book

I just do reverse forecasts on every race inside on the tote

But the tote prices are just indications and because
Most people who go are just betting on anything, the final price could really be any thing.

I've seen odds on favourites returning at 3/1 and outsiders being evens
